A physical therapist is examining a patient who presents with symptoms consistent with pronator syndrome. Which of the following findings would MOST likely be observed during the examination?

Option 1- Weakness of the wrist extensors

Option 2- Sensory loss over the dorsal aspect of the hand

Option 3- Weakness of the finger flexors

Option 4- Pain over the lateral elbow
